基于嵌入式ARM的远程视频监控系统研究..docx 立即下载
2025-08-26
约2.6万字
约39页
0
33KB
举报 版权申诉
预览加载中,请您耐心等待几秒...

基于嵌入式ARM的远程视频监控系统研究..docx

基于嵌入式ARM的远程视频监控系统研究..docx

预览

免费试读已结束,剩余 34 页请下载文档后查看

10 金币

下载文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于嵌入式ARM的远程视频监控系统研究.

第一篇:基于嵌入式ARM的远程视频监控系统研究.基于嵌入式ARM的远程视频监控系统研究随着科技的进步,视频监控系统正在向嵌入式、数字化、网络化方向发展。嵌入式视频监控系统充分利用大规模集成电路和网络的科技成果,实现了体积小巧、性能稳定、通讯便利的监控产品。本文以S3C2410为核心硬件平台开发了基于嵌入式的远程视频监控系统,并对关键技术进行了论述和研究。首先给出了系统总体软硬件设计方案,针对本系统硬件对vivi进行了修改和移植,对编译和移植Linux内核以及制作YAFFS文件系统也做了深入的研究,重点讨论了在嵌入式Linux操作系统下开发USB接口摄像头驱动程序和利用linux提供的Video4LinuxAPI函数实现视频数据采集,其次采用背景差法实现了对视频图像中运动目标的检测,然后通过MJPEG压缩算法实现了视频数据压缩,接着介绍了在Linux下基于TCP/IP协议的socket编程,实现了视频数据的网络发送。最后着重论述了嵌入式Web服务器的设计,编写了视频监控主界面程序,并实现了基于B/S模式的视频监控系统结构。本系统采用模块化设计方法,使得设计更加简洁、高效,具有良好的扩展性和易用性,有利于系统升级。另外采用嵌入式的方法,系统成本较低,易于推广使用。【关键词相关文档搜索】:控制理论与控制工程;ARM;嵌入式Linux;USB摄像头;Video4Linux;嵌入式Web服务器【作者相关信息搜索】:南京理工大学;控制理论与控制工程;陈青林;李保国;第二篇:基于ARM嵌入式的远程监控系统设计基于ARM嵌入式的远程监控系统设计摘要:基于ARM内核的嵌入式系统在远程监控报警系统中的设计实现与应用。核心部分主要包括ARM嵌入式平台设计及μC-OS嵌入式实时操作系统移植;人机交互界面μCGUI的设计与实现;远程通讯及自动报警等;系统的设计还考虑到了扩展性和通用性以及与其他监控设备无缝连接等问题。关键词:ARM;μC/OS-II;μCGUI;远程监控引言监控系统现已成为现代化生产、生活中不可缺少的重要组成部分。目前,监控系列产品种类繁多,大部分广泛应用于交通、医院、银行、家居、学校等安防领域。随着嵌入式系统的出现,尤其是基于ARM内核芯片的嵌入式系统的出现,使得监控系统的应用领域更为广泛。本文设计的远程监控报警系统除了作为安防功能外,还可以应用于以下领域:通讯领域:远程通讯、视频会议和视频点播、证券、远程教育等。医疗领域:病房监护、远程诊断等。工业领域:远程设备诊断、维护、维修,远程生产监控等。家用领域:家用电器远程维护;电、气、火等重大事故自动报警等。系统设计2.1系统组成本文设计的远程监控系统主要由中心控制器、数据终端、传感器模块、通讯模块、接口模块等几部分组成。系统组成图(如图1)。2.2中心控制器系统核心负责数据采集判断处理。为了提高系统工作效率,这里使用的是三星公司的S3C2410芯片作为处理器。S3C2410芯片是一款高性价比的ARM芯片,非常适合作手机、PDA等手持设备。主要特性包括:ARM920T内核,最高工作频率203MHz,LCD控制器:可直接驱动真彩液晶屏,最高支持2048×1024真彩液晶屏,2个USBHost端口,1个USBDevice端口,支持Nandflash启动模式,SD卡接口,UART、IIC、SPI、IIS等多种类型串行接口,4通道DMA。本文的监控系统的CPU核心部分使用的是标准的SO-DIMM200金手指接口,便于后期维护和升级。如果该监控系统的使用环境较为苛刻,可以将CPU替换为S3C2440芯片。S3C2440完全兼容S3C2410全部特性(注意:芯片引脚不完全兼容)。与S3C2410芯片相比,S3C2440的性能更为优越:最高工作频率可达500MHz,内部集成CMOS摄像头接口,但价格较昂贵。图1监控系统组成框图2.3数据终端数据终端的主要功能是对监控数据进行分析、处理,及时将数据汇报给监控人员。同时,监控人员可以根据现场情况,使用数据终端对监控的设备进行远程控制。数据终端最大优势就是安全、可靠、便于携带。一般情况下为了节约成本,可以将手机、PDA等移动通讯设备作为数据终端使用。但是如果作为对高危环境或精密仪器的监控系统,数据终端需要专业定制。这里使用的是中心控制器的作为数据终端,即中心控制器既作为数据采集发送中心,也可数据接收处理中心使用。2.4通讯模块通讯模块主要负责远程数据通讯。带有RS232/485、GPRS、CDMA等一种或多种通讯方式。需要根据现场环境和用户需要进行定制。通讯模块与控制器通过接口总线连接,连接方式为TTL/RS232/RS485等。2.5传感器模块传感器模块的主要功能是感知外部环境,对外部环境进行实时监测。由人体红外
查看更多
单篇购买
VIP会员(1亿+VIP文档免费下)

扫码即表示接受《下载须知》

基于嵌入式ARM的远程视频监控系统研究.

文档大小:33KB

限时特价:扫码查看

• 请登录后再进行扫码购买
• 使用微信/支付宝扫码注册及付费下载,详阅 用户协议 隐私政策
• 如已在其他页面进行付款,请刷新当前页面重试
• 付费购买成功后,此文档可永久免费下载
全场最划算
12个月
199.0
¥360.0
限时特惠
3个月
69.9
¥90.0
新人专享
1个月
19.9
¥30.0
24个月
398.0
¥720.0
6个月会员
139.9
¥180.0

6亿VIP文档任选,共次下载特权。

已优惠

微信/支付宝扫码完成支付,可开具发票

VIP尽享专属权益

VIP文档免费下载

赠送VIP文档免费下载次数

阅读免打扰

去除文档详情页间广告

专属身份标识

尊贵的VIP专属身份标识

高级客服

一对一高级客服服务

多端互通

电脑端/手机端权益通用